First edition, unopened in original printed wrappers, of pasteurs definitive proof that alcoholic fermentation is due to the action of a living organism yeast, and is not a purely chemical process as most chemists since lavoisier had believed.

Fermentation is a traditional method of reducing the microbial contamination of porridges in kenya watson, ngesa, onyang, alnwick and tomkins, 1996 a study in tanzania has shown that children fed with fermented gruels had a 33% lower incidence of diarrhoea than those fed unfermented gruels, owing to the inhibition of pathogenic bacteria by.
